    Scotchies is the BEST, in my book. I've tried the others, and I've tried jerk all over the island (including the world-famous Boston jerk), but Scotchies has the best smoked flavor. They also have a consistent selection of roast yam, breadfruit, sw potato, bammie, bean & dumpling soup. I stop there each reach, often before I leave MoBay ... but ALWAYS before I board my plane, I take a to-go lunch with me for the flight.
    Having said that, my favorite jerk sauce is one that's made by a jerk centre near Runaway Bay .... Ultimate Jerk Centre .... It's right across the street from the Green Grotto Caves on the Queens Hwy.
